Abstract

The neuropsychiatric symptoms and disorders among endocrine disorders are discussed in the context of current global and local epidemiological data. Neuropsychiatric symptoms, clinical differentials in hypothyroidism, hyperthyroidism, and parathyroid disorders, and relevant management protocols are described. HPT axis and its interaction with psychotropic usage are mentioned. Stress diathesis, depression, anxiety disorders, and severe mental illnesses and their respective association with diabetes, the relevant mechanisms, and management protocols are stated. The metabolic syndrome, its definition, and its relationship to psychotropic usage are laid out. Moreso, best clinical practices for scenarios such as hyperprolactinemia and psychiatric illnesses, and steroid-induced psychosis are mentioned.
